Black hole mass against the host galaxy stellar mass M* for delayed merger remnants (green crosses), numerical merger remnants (blue points), and the global population of main BHs (orange hexagons), at redshift 3.5 < z < 4. For the hexagons, darker colours correspond to a higher density of points, on a logarithmic scale. The geometric mean of M in several bins of M* is shown by the solid lines for the three samples of BHs, with shaded regions corresponding to the 1σ error in the mean. The relation for numerical mergers is very similar to that of the full BH population, while the relation for delayed mergers is slightly shifted to higher BH masses in galaxies with mass M* = 109 − 1010M.
